From her rad undercut to cross-body bag, this Fashionista brings a modern twist to some cool vintage vibes. She is particularly on point with her choice of the color burgundy for her overall outfit theme. Warm colors like burgundy and orange are super on trend, partly due to the ’70s throwback in action this season, and also because they’re part of the classic fall pallet. With her corduroy circle skirt from American Apparel, this Fashionista rocks a fall-inspired outfit while working with the Florida heat.

Other ways to try the burgundy trend this fall include throwing a motorcycle jacket over a T-shirt dress or jeans for instant Rebel Without A Cause feels. Take your florals from summer into the colder months with a moodier print like this one, and wear it with a pair of black tights and motorcycle boots for a girly/grunge combo. You could also tie a denim shirt around your waist as the perfect neutral to balance the floral pattern. In my opinion denim shirts are the perfect outerwear choice for anytime in Florida, but that’s the subject for another article. Or you can eschew burgundy clothing choices and go the beauty route. Try a matching hair and lipstick combination like this Fashionista for a bold statement.
